Two for the Blues
Two for the Blues is an album by saxophonists Frank [Foster |Frank Foster] and Frank Wess which was recorded in 1983 and released on the Pablo label the following year.
Reception
The AllMusic review by Scott Yanow said it "features Frank Foster and Frank Wess at their best.... this is an excellent showcase for the two Franks".Track listing

Personnel
- Frank Foster – soprano saxophone, tenor saxophone
- Frank Wess – alto saxophone, tenor saxophone, flute
- Kenny Barron – piano
- Rufus Reid – double bass
- Marvin Smith – drums
